In this emotional journey, we share the story of Leland Shoemake, a 6-year-old boy from Williamson, Georgia.

Leland was not an ordinary child; his radiant joy, keen intelligence, and inventive spirit touched the hearts of everyone who knew him. From a young age, he displayed an incredible thirst for knowledge. By the time he was just one year old, Leland already knew his ABCs, numbers, colors, shapes, and 20 sight words. His love for learning extended to the History Channel, the Weather Channel, documentaries, and anything related to history.

But fate had other plans for Leland. In 2015, he fell ill unexpectedly and was rushed to the hospital. Doctors soon discovered that he had a brain infection caused by the amoeba Balamuthia mandrillaris. It remains unclear how Leland contracted the bacteria, but it is possible that he encountered it while playing outside.

As his condition rapidly deteriorated, Leland’s parents, Amber and Tim Shoemake, were overcome with grief. They had to say their final goodbyes to their beloved son at the hospital. When they returned home, engulfed by waves of sorrow, they discovered something on their living room table that brought them both comfort and pain.

Leland had always been known for leaving sweet notes and drawings for his parents. And in this heartbreaking moment, his parents found one last note from their beloved son. It simply read, “Stil (sic) with you… Thank you mom and dad… Love.” Leland had also drawn a red heart enclosing three words: mom, dad, and love.

This note, a small piece of Leland’s heart, provided a profound consolation to his grieving parents. It reminded them of the immense love they shared with their son and brought some solace during this unimaginable loss. As his mother said, “We have no idea when he wrote it, but you can tell he was always a special child.”
